GoDaddy copyright : Troubleshooting

Having difficulty accessing your My GoDaddy account? Don't panic! Numerous challenges can prevent a successful access experience. First, verify your username and PIN – errors are a frequent culprit. Review whether your Caps Lock key is enabled. If that doesn't correct the problem, use the "Forgot Password?" link on the copyright area. You might also be required to remove your web cookies and reload the page. In conclusion, confirm your software is up-to-date and supported with GoDaddy's services. If you're still facing challenges, get in touch with GoDaddy help for further help.
